Affinity Capture-MS

An interaction is inferred when a bait protein is affinity captured from cell extracts by either polyclonal antibody or epitope tag and the associated interaction partner is identified by mass spectrometric methods.

p62/SQSTM1 Fuels Melanoma Progression by Opposing mRNA Decay of a Selective Set of Pro-metastatic Factors.

Karras P, Riveiro-Falkenbach E, Canon E, Tejedo C, Calvo TG, Martinez-Herranz R, Alonso-Curbelo D, Cifdaloz M, Perez-Guijarro E, Gomez-Lopez G, Ximenez-Embun P, Munoz J, Megias D, Olmeda D, Moscat J, Ortiz-Romero PL, Rodriguez-Peralto JL, Soengas MS

Modulators of mRNA stability are not well understood in melanoma, an aggressive tumor with complex changes in the transcriptome. Here we report the ability of p62/SQSTM1 to extend mRNA half-life of a spectrum of pro-metastatic factors. These include FERMT2 and other transcripts with no previous links to melanoma. Transcriptomic, proteomic, and interactomic analyses, combined with validation in clinical biopsies and ... [more]
